Orange County, FL. – A 30-year-old Kissimmee man was killed after a deadly crash on Saturday afternoon in Orange County, according to the Florida Highway Patrol.
The deadly collision occurred at about 5:12 p.m. at Orange Avenue and Mary Louise Lane.
Troopers said a Yamaha FJ-09 motorcycle was heading south on Orange Avenue, north of Mark Louise Lane when the driver did not negotiate a left-hand curve and headed southwest towards the shoulder.
The motorcycle hit a guardrail ejecting the motorcycle from the bike
The driver, identified as a 30-year-old Kissimmee man, was declared dead at the crash site.
No additional information concerning this crash was provided.
An investigation is ongoing.
